Tissue Expression Profiling Using Triple A Polyclonals
Triple A Polyclonals™ (Atlas Antibodies Advanced Polyclonals) are research-grade rabbit polyclonals developed within the Human Protein Atlas project. Triple A Polyclonals are specific, reproducible, and versatile. Read below to learn about their unique advantages.
Each Triple A Polyclonal is analyzed in 44 normal human tissues and the 20 most common cancers using IHC. All protein expression profiles are conveniently searchable online on the Human Protein Atlas portal.
